This psychiatry position in Indianapolis, Indiana is offered as a Single-Specialty Group opportunity, meaning you would join an established practice of psychiatrists. In this arrangement, clinical infrastructure, staffing, billing, and administration are already in place, and call responsibilities are typically shared among the group's physicians. The setting is designed to offer peer collaboration within your specialty along with shared business overhead, reducing the individual administrative load compared to solo practice.
